Safety

Many wall mounted electric fireplaces have a screening that is kept at an extremely low temperature throughout the fireplace's use and helps prevent burns. They also operate and maintain temperatures at a lower level than traditional fireplaces, which makes them suitable for homes with children or pets. Certain models come with features, like the fire-only mode, which allows you enjoy the appearance of a fire without the heat.

Generally speaking, electric fireplaces are intended to be used as supplemental heating sources, not primary ones. You should always follow the instructions and safety guidelines included with your specific model to ensure proper operation and safety. Be sure that the area around your fireplace is clear of combustible substances and is not obstructed by drapes or furniture. It is essential to keep anything that could ignite at least three feet away from the fireplace in order to reduce fire risk and allow for ventilation of hot air. You should also check the vents regularly to ensure they are clear of obstructions and there enough fresh air to effectively operate your fireplace.

You should be alert to any unusual noises or smells that may occur when your fireplace is being used. These can be a sign of mechanical or electrical issues that could cause serious safety hazards and should be immediately addressed by an expert.

While it is not typical to experience accidents involving electric fireplaces, they must be considered to be dangerous appliances that require proper installation and use. A qualified electrician should perform the installation and be aware of local codes and regulations pertaining to the use of electric fireplaces. They should also be able to provide you with information on the warranty maintenance, replacement and repair of parts.
